    Report Creator Missing Parts from Model

    277 Views, 7 Replies
    01-06-2012 04:32 AM

    hi,

     

    i made a 3D Part list with the Report Creator from one DWG of the project but i miss some parts. i have this problem for some models of the project. and the doesn`t calculate the pipe lentgh right. (i have a ~40000mm pipe in the model but in the part list is the pipe lentgh ~60000mm)

    The parts are in the model, also in the Data Mangaer correct but not in the Part list. i have no idea where isn´t it.

    Re: Report Creator Missing Parts from Model

    05-11-2012 04:44 AM in reply to: HermannSemlitsch5177

    This is caused when the default PArtSizeLongDesc is NOT used I.e. includeing the Size.

     

    To fix this, add a Group Sort under the EngineeringItems.ShortDesription

    as

    EngineeringItems.PartSizeLongDesc

    and all will be corrected.

    Re: Report Creator Missing Parts from Model

    07-13-2012 02:30 AM in reply to: HermannSemlitsch5177

    The problem was in the implementation of the PartSizeLongDescription in the Specs / Catalogues used which was being “summated” with data which was not unique.

     

    The spec Format used does not adhere to the Autodesk delivered Spec Philosophy, whereby the Nominal Diameter is added to the above field.  This caused the incorrect grouping of the Reported Items, manually reporting on the database confirmed this to be the case.

    The report creator was acting exactly on the data being presented, the data presented to the report was not as designed.

     

    What we have done in this correction to your project implementation is add a Sort to unique criteria as below  by adding a Group Sort on PartSizeLongDesc.
